My husband loves this vise
I bought this for my husband as a shop-gift. It took him a little while to decide how he wanted to mount the vise (it's large), and I helped him with the installation.You have to be careful how you install the quick-release. I think that some of the negative reviews about the feature are coming from folks who installed the release chuck backwards, because that is exactly what we did on the first pass. The vise wouldn't release, and with me under the bench, helping with the install, I was able to describe what I was seeing. That helped my husband figure out that it was linked to the orientation of that quick-release "feature". So I could see how it would be easy to do that if someone is trying to install the vise without assistance, because it is all the way under the bench and you can't really watch AND try to release it yourself at the same time.So what I would suggest from this experience (as the wife who doesn't run the shop but often assists there) is that you get an extra set of hands to do the install smoothly. This vice is one of my husband's favorite new features in there. He says it's a very good quality vise that should last a long time.Other info - you get a relatively large box from Rockler, and it is heavy. We didn't have any issues with damage during shipping, as I have seen reported for many vices including this one. For those of you looking at this as a potential gift, and probably not as someone who often works with vices...this is a substantial piece of metal coming in the mail. The owner will need wood and other materials to complete the installation. Just FYI.

Poorly manufactured
The part that mounts to the underside of the workbench was poorly cast. The center of the face that mounts flush to the rear jaws has a significant protrusion and it's darn near impossible to ensure that it will be mounted squarely because of it. If it's off by a bit, it'll cause racking. I'd suggest getting a different end vise; one that has better manufacturing. Also, one that is NOT sold by Rockler.
